In what sort of assemblages, the strategies and digital policies in organization are made''' Beyond digital mantras and management slogans/fictions, what is the concrete factory of information management system'' What are the parts of the human and no human actors' Is it possible to create a new approach to understand how work change (or not), to explore the potential for a social and cognitive innovation way, considering simultaneously the increase of Data Management and the organizational analytics'
